Garrison, NE vs Obert, NE
There is a significant gap in the cost of living between these two cities. Garrison is 20.2% cheaper than Obert. With a cost index of 77 vs 97, the difference would have a meaningful impact on a household's monthly budget. Someone relocating from Garrison to Obert should plan for substantially higher expenses across most categories.
Median household income in Garrison is $71,250 compared to $55,313 in Obert (+28.8%). Garrison offers a double advantage: higher earnings combined with a lower cost of living, giving residents significantly more purchasing power.
Climate-wise, Garrison is notably warmer with an average of 52.3°F compared to 48.7°F in Obert. Garrison receives more rainfall at 29.3" per year compared to 28.7" in Obert.
